United States GP Secures Long-Term Future as Max Verstappen Starting First
The iconic F1 race in the Lone Star State will continue to excite spectators until 2034, thanks to a new long-term agreement keeping its spot on the calendar.
"Since it first appeared on the Formula 1 calendar in 2012, the US GP has evolved into one of the sport’s biggest spectacles," remarked Formula 1 chief Stefano Domenicali.
"Each year, the race at the Circuit of the Americas stands out as an unforgettable experience for everyone involved in motorsport."
